Neighborhood Overview
The Brian Burch Memorial Sports Park is situated in the heart of the quiet, rural community of Amo, providing a focused environment for competitive sports. Access to the facility is primarily via local state routes that connect to the broader Indianapolis metropolitan area, making it accessible for regional travel teams. Parking is located directly on-site in large, flat lots designed to handle high volumes of passenger vehicles and passenger vans. The nearest major air travel hub is Indianapolis International Airport, which typically requires a drive of approximately 30 to 40 minutes depending on traffic conditions.
Navigating to and from the complex is straightforward as the roads are generally uncongested compared to urban centers. We recommend planning your arrival at least 45 minutes before your first scheduled match to account for walking from the parking areas to your designated field. Rideshare services are available but can be limited in this rural setting, so having a dedicated team vehicle is highly advised for your group. Always monitor local traffic reports if you are traveling during major weekday commute hours, as regional roadwork can occasionally impact travel times on secondary highways.
Where to Stay
Most visiting teams choose to stay in the nearby town of Plainfield, which offers a robust selection of hotel options just a short drive east of the sports park. This area provides a variety of chain hotels that are well-equipped to handle team bookings, including those with breakfast service and fitness centers. While there are no hotels within immediate walking distance of the complex, the drive from the Plainfield corridor is efficient and direct.
Demand for local lodging spikes significantly during tournament weekends, so we strongly recommend booking your accommodations several weeks in advance. Many hotels in the vicinity are accustomed to hosting athletic teams and offer flexible room configurations for larger groups. If you are traveling as a large organization, consider calling the hotels directly to inquire about block rates and bus parking availability. Planning your stay in the Plainfield hub ensures you remain close to both the fields and the essential dining options needed for your team.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winter in Indiana is cold and often snowy, making outdoor field activities impractical. Temperatures frequently drop below freezing, requiring heavy winter gear for any necessary visits. The area is quiet during this time, with most athletic activity moving to indoor facilities elsewhere.
Spring & early summer
This season is highly variable with a mix of sunny days and frequent rain showers. Visitors should pack layers, including waterproof jackets and comfortable, mud-resistant footwear for the fields. It is a beautiful time to visit as the landscape turns green and vibrant.
Mid-summer
Expect hot and humid conditions with plenty of sunshine throughout the day. It is essential to wear lightweight, breathable clothing and use sun protection such as hats and sunscreen. High temperatures make shade management a top priority for all teams at the park.
Fall season
Fall provides some of the most comfortable weather for outdoor sports, characterized by cool mornings and pleasant afternoons. Pack a mix of light layers to adjust to the shifting temperatures throughout the day. The foliage in the surrounding area is often quite scenic during this period.
Rain & snow
Rain is common during the spring and fall, which can sometimes impact the condition of the playing fields. Snow is primarily limited to the winter months and can cause local road delays. Always check tournament status updates if significant precipitation is in the forecast.
